Min
Computes the minimum value of an array.
Installation
$ npm install compute-minFor use in the browser, use browserify.
Usage
To use the module,
var min = require( 'compute-min' );min( arr )
Computes the minimum value of an array.
var data = [ 3, 2, 5, 2, 10 ];
var val = min( data );
// returns 2Examples
